New York: Palgrave, Date: 2007. First Edition, First Printing. Hardcover. Near fine/near fine. First edition of A Time To Lead by General Wesley A. Clark, inscribed to National Security Advisor, Brent Scowcroft.. Octavo, x, 262pp. White hardcover, title stamped in gilt on spine. Stated "first edition" on copyright page, with a full number line. Solid text block, in fine condition. In the publisher's near fine dust jacket, retail price on the front flap, faint shelf wear. Signed on the title page by the co-author, Tom Carhart. Inscription reads: "To General Brent Scowcroft, With deepest respect for your leadership and service. Wes." A fine association copy between two giants of 20th Century military history. Brent Scowcroft (1925-2020) served as the National Security Advisor for President Gerald R. Ford and President George H.W. Bush. After leaving the Bush administration, he wrote A World Transformed with President George H.W. Bush, which was an insiders' account of the White House after the fall of the Soviet Union. In 2001, President George W. Bush appointed Scowcroft the Chair of the President's Intelligence Advisory Board, where he found himself at odds with Vice President Cheney on the Iraq Invasion. In 2008, he published America and the World: Conversations on the Future of American Foreign Policy, along with Zbigniew Brzezinski. General Wesley Clark (b. 1944) was Supreme Allied Commander Europe from 1997-2000, then ran for the democratic nomination in 2004. 2007. ...
